2. The setting of the story is very limited; it is confined largely to a room, a staircase, and a front
Mrac [35]

Answer: The limited set of the story may be viewed in relation to the trials and tribulations that Mrs. Mallard possibly endured throughout her marriage to Brently Mallard.  The staircase may signify the “ups and downs” encountered by Mrs. Mallard; it could also represent her path to freedom as she walks toward them to descend to victory.  The room could represent the “box” encapsulating a person that suffers from depression or anxiety, with the window located inside the room representing the happiness that seems unattainable even though it is visible.  I could equate the door to a possible exit from the situation or an object, whether physical or mental, that kept Mrs. Mallard “locked in” and unable to reach the happiness that waited outside.  I was able to associate the set to the apparent despair, excitement and eventual heart-break that was experienced by Mrs. Mallard as she learned of her husband’s death, into the jubilation of being “free” and finally to her demise as she watched her husband walk through the door

How does the setting support Mrs. Mallard's new feelings about freedom? A. It is in the home where Mrs. Mallard feels safe. B. I
Sonja [21]

The answer is D. It is springtime when trees bloom and birds sing.

Explanation:

Mrs Mallard goes through a sea of emotions when she learns about her husband's death. At first, she is shocked but what follows is what defines her married life. She goes to her room and sits by the window, she feels happy from the inside. It's as if she had gotten back her freedom, she sits in her comfy, room armchair and finds herself at peace when she looks outside the open window during the springtime, as the trees are blooming and the birds are singing.
